Hey, here's yet another clip of a guitar from my collection, this is the 5th video. This time out it's my $10 Value Village find, a 1966 Regal Stella made by Harmony. Based off the Harmony H929 this is a R200. Great little old style blues guitar, suprisingly fun to play, I find myself playing it all the time. Gives you an idea of their cool sound. Well worth picking one up as they are cheap as nails, if you find a good player you're in buisness!

Hey, the action on this one is great & low, almost too low, it frets out after the 13th fret (but I'm never gonna want to play past there on this guitar anyway) it plays really easy, nice loose string tension.
I didn't really need to fix anything, cleaned it up because there was crayon all over it, I replaced the tuners, as there were a couple buttons missing.
Not too say all of them are this playable but if you can get one with a nice tight neck joint you should be okay. Good luck!
